Skip to content

A D&D 5e monster maker module for the Foundry VTT. Build new monsters with level-appropriate, balanced stats in seconds. This is a fork which has been updated to GGMM PDF v3, Foundry v10+11, and dnd5e 2.1+3.1.

Notifications You must be signed in to change notification settings

Skyl3lazer/giffyglyph-monster-maker-continued

 
 

Repository files navigation

Monster Maker Social Banner

Giffyglyph's 5e Monster Maker Continued, by Skyl3lazer

Pull Requests Welcome Support Giffy on Patreon BlueSky Discord

This is a continuation of the original module by Giffyglyph, updated to be compatable Foundry v10/11 and D&D 2.2.x/3.1.x. (Also check out my v3 updated Webapp!)

NOTE: There are still signposting issues around! Not all tooltips, etc, have been updated.

If you find issues not already listed in DEV_TODO please leave an Issue here or contact me @Skyl3lazer on Discord.

Want to build new monsters for your Foundry VTT D&D 5e campaign, but aren't sure how to balance them easily? No worries—Giffyglyph's 5e Monster Maker has you covered! Build level-appropriate D&D 5e monsters in seconds with an all-new automated monster sheet and scaling actions.

Features

  • A brand new monster sheet with customisable themes.
  • Fully-scaled monster stats for levels -5 to 50.
  • 4 monster roles — minion, standard, elite, and paragons.
  • 6 combat roles — controller, defender, lurker, skirmisher, striker, and supporter.
  • Change the level of any monster on-the-fly and watch their stats change.
  • A new scaling action sheet with fully-scaling attacks.
  • Premade attacks, traits and powers to easily create unique, thematic, and interesting monsters.
  • Easy-to-use shortcodes to make custom scaling features even easier.
  • Convert existing monsters in seconds by simply changing the active sheet.
  • Includes full stats from the Giffyglyph's Monster Maker PDF.

Scaling Adult Dragon

Installation

Dependencies

These modules are required for GMMC to function.

  • libwrapper - Allows GMMC to interact nicely with other modules, including the optional modules.

Recommended Modules

These modules are optional, but may improve the experience of using GMMC.

  • Midi QOL - Provides automation, which some compendium items have built in already if Midi is active.
  • Dfred's Convenient Effects - Included in the /importable/ folder is a dfreds-ce-import.json file which you can import to include the Conditions compendium in DFred's CE! This makes it easier to apply the conditions rather than needing to transfer them from the compendium actor.

You can install this Foundry module by copying a manifest URL into your Foundry setup:

You can install multiple branches side-by-side, but you must activate only one branch at a time.

Incompatibilities / Differences

  • Some modules may have limited functionality with shortcodes in various fields. If you attempt to roll something and it doesn't roll, please submit an issue with your modlist.

Getting Started

  1. Install and activate the module.
  2. On the sidebar under "Actors, you will see "Create a Scaling Monster". Click it.
  3. Customise your monster by changing the level, rank, and role. See your monster's stats update live with each change.
  4. On the sidebar under "Items", you will see "Create a Scaling Action". Click it. You can also click the "Add" button next to the Actions section on your monster.
  5. Customise your action by adding an attack — try a "Melee Weapon Attack"!
  6. Now drag the scaling action onto your scaling monster, and watch the action's attack bonus automatically change to match your monster's bonuses.

Converting an old Monster

  1. Open an existing monster, or import one from the SRD compendium.
  2. Change the active sheet to "Giffyglyph's 5e Monster Maker".
  3. Change the monster's level, rank, and role to suit the expected encounter.

Converting an old Action

  1. Open an existing item, such as a weapon, feature, or piece of loot.
  2. Change the active sheet to "Giffyglyph's 5e Scaling Action".
  3. Customise the action with some scaling features and shortcodes.

Scaling Action

Roadmap

Currently this release can handle GMMv3 functions as a standalone module, with some basic integrations working through other modules (MidiQOL, DAE). See DEV_TODO for what I'm looking at next.

Thank Yous!

Big shoutout to @krigsmaskine on Discord for assistance with the tsponey modules and general testing

Bugs and Feature Suggestions

If you notice a bug or have a feature suggestion, visit the issue board and open a ticket. Please make sure to be as thorough as possible in your report and attach screenshots where appropriate, as low-effort tickets may be closed out-of-hand.

Support

Support Giffy on Patreon BlueSky

You can also see an updated GMMv3 webapp I've created here

If you'd like to support the original creator of this module, please consider becoming a patron. You can also find more of Giffy's work at:

Licensing

This module is licensed under the Foundry Virtual Tabletop EULA: Limited License Agreement for module development.

About

A D&D 5e monster maker module for the Foundry VTT. Build new monsters with level-appropriate, balanced stats in seconds. This is a fork which has been updated to GGMM PDF v3, Foundry v10+11, and dnd5e 2.1+3.1.

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ages

  • HTML 42.5%
  • JavaScript 27.2%
  • CSS 18.9%
  • SCSS 11.4%